Required Skills:1. Strong experience with component qualifications (PPAP preferred), Process Validation (IQ/OQ/PQ), and working with suppliers.2. Experience with remediating existing Quality Records to meet Good Documentation Practices (GDP) and rigorous attention to detail per FDA regulations.3. Experience working under aggressive project timelines that require collaborating with multiple functions including R&D, Manufacturing, QA and Incoming Inspection. Responsibilities may include the following and other duties may be assigned. Ensures that suppliers deliver quality parts, materials, and services. Qualifies suppliers according to company standards and may administer a Certified Supplier Program in receiving inspection to ensure cost effectiveness. Monitors parts from acquisition through the manufacturing cycle and communicates and resolves supplier related problems as they occur. Develops and prioritizes an auditing schedule to ensure that designated suppliers are audited on a regular basis to ensure good manufacturing practices (GMP) and quality standards are met. Evaluates suppliers' internal functions to assess their overall performance and provides feedback in assessment of their operation. Differentiating Factors: 1.
